GAE-Image-Server

Use GAE Blobstore to host your images. Upload image and profiles (Quality/Size). Serve Image for a given profile (resize on the fly). Note that Quality indicator does not apply in case of png image. In that case the png format is used for storage to keep transparency. In other cases, file will be saved as jpeg.

The application is written in GO and should be deployed to GAE. As the blostore requires a callback url, to ease local testing, you will find a Dockerfile that will allow you to run locally an AppEngine instance configured for the project. It can also be used to deploy the application.

Upload

To get the "url action" to put in the upload form:

http://{img_baseURL}/action | GET

Example of form to be used in the upload page:

http://{baseURL}/exampleForm | GET

Of course the form will have to post the file to be uploaded, but note also the 2 important fields that help to index the image and continue the flow:

<input type="text" name="entityId" value="myId">
<input type="text" name="callbackurl" value="http://0.0.0.0:8080/callbacktest">

Once the form is posted to the blobstore action, the file will be stored, and the callbackurl will be invoked with the updated form. All the input parameters of the initial form will be transfered.

Image Profiles

Retrieve the list of existing profiles:

http://{baseURL}/imgProfiles | GET

This returns a JSON flat list containing the list of profile names:

[
"original",      // This profil is created by default, and  is associated by default to any uploaded image (+resize if needed)
"small"
]

Retrieve a specific profile:

http://{baseURL}/imgProfile/{profileName} | GET

Delete a specific profile:

http://{baseURL}/imgProfile/{profileName} | DELETE

This removes all the files associated to the profile.

Create or update a specific profile:

http://{baseURL}/imgProfile | POST | JSON {
        "name" : "small",
        "quality" : 50,
        "maxSize" : 100
}

Note that to update a profile you need to post a JSON with the name associated to the profile to update. So far a modification of the profile does dot trig a resizing/recomputation of the images associated to the profile. To force the resizing/recomputation, you need to delete the profile. This will remove (asynchronously) all the images associated to the profile. The each image will be recomputed for the new profile when being queried for the first time.

Images

Retrieve an image associated to an entityId for a given profile:

http://{baseURL}/image/{entityId}/{profileName} | GET

If the image does not exist for the requested profile, it will be computed on the fly, provided an original image is associated to the entityId

Delete an image for a given profile:

http://{baseURL}/image/{entityId}/{profileName} | DELETE

Delete all the images (all profiles) associated to an entityId:

http://{baseURL}/image/{entityId} | DELETE

Note that this kind of deletion is done asynchronously using task queues. This means that the image can still be accessible for a short period.

func NewCompressionOptions

func NewCompressionOptions(r *http.Request) *compressionOptions

* Create new set of options. * * - Sets Quality to 75 as default. 75 is highly compressed but not visually noticable. * - Sets Size to 0 which means that no changes to images dimensions will be made. * - Creates new App Engine context.

func ParseBlobs

func ParseBlobs(options *compressionOptions) (blobs map[string][]*blobstore.BlobInfo, other url.Values, err error)

* This one does the magic. * * - Gets the uploaded blobs by calling blobstore.ParseUpload() * - Maintains all other values that come from blobstore. * - Hands out the results for further processing.

func Resample

func Resample(m image.Image, r image.Rectangle, w, h int) image.Image

Resample returns a resampled copy of the image slice r of m. The returned image has width w and height h.

func Resize

func Resize(m image.Image, r image.Rectangle, w, h int) image.Image

Resize returns a scaled copy of the image slice r of m. The returned image has width w and height h.
